SCUBA DIVING Sarasota and Florida’s West Coast
Offers many options for diving.
The west coastline of Florida stretches from Bronson, the Crystal River and Gainsville in the north, to Clearwater and St. Petersburg mid-state, and Sarasota, and Venice at the southern tip.
WEST FLORIDA SCUBA DIVING covers some incredibly varied diving. Bronson is world famous for its spring, cave and cavern diving. Technical divers come from all over the world to test their skills here and much of this diving is advanced. Meanwhile, the Crystal River offers incredible opportunities to snorkel, and if you’re lucky, to dive with manatee.
With no natural reefs, the Tampa Bay area is relatively flat undersea but nevertheless has one of the most extensive, well-maintained artificial reef systems in Florida. Reefs have been built of everything from bridge rubble, to shipwrecks like Blackthorn, Gunsmoke and Sheridan – and even army tanks. This region better known for spear-fishing.
If you’re into fossils, then the Venice area offers the sharp-eyed diver the chance to find prehistoric Megalodon teeth in the exposed fossil beds offshore. Many divers venture here for this reason alone. And remember, beach diving is free!
